42 piece ALL ALUMINUM RADIUS ROD CONE SPACER KIT 1/2" BOLTS

Our loaded 42 piece kit comes with a great assortment of spacers for 1/2" dia. bolts.  All fully contained in a plastic snap lid container for easy storage in your Trailer, Tool Box, or War Wagon

Features:

  • 42 Pieces Total
  • 1/2" ID x 3/4" OD Tapered Cone Shape Design
  • All Made from High Quality American Aluminum
  • Each Kit Contains:
    •  (12)  1/8"
    • (12)  1/4"
    • (8) 3/8"
    • (6) 1/2"
    • (4)  3/4"

 

  •  Made in the USA by Greber Racing Components.

New Chevrolet Caprice tuned to police needs

Tue, 27 Jul 2010

The new Chevrolet Caprice police patrol vehicle will hit the streets in April 2011, and orders from departments will begin in January. The Caprice will join the Impala and the Tahoe as the bow-tie brand's offerings for police. The new Chevy will feature a 6.0-liter V8 engine pumping out 355 hp and 384 lb-ft of torque.
